The variety of housing throughout Western Sydney leads to a similarly varied series of requirements for rubbish‑removal services in the area. Older neighbourhoods near the Sydney basin-- heritage and post‑war suburbs-- function mature homes where restorations, estate clear‑outs, and long‑term resident clean‑ups develop a continuous demand for waste collection. Further west, the fast‑expanding release zones, filled with new housing estates where families are building homes at a quick rate, produce building and construction particles, packaging waste, and the initial buildup that accompanies the establishment of new families and gardens. On the semi‑rural fringe, large‑acre residential or commercial properties create a various set of needs, frequently including large volumes of green waste, farm‑related particles, and products that need to be managed with care because of the size of the holdings. Rubbish‑removal companies in Western Sydney that have established abilities to serve all these sections can provide a level of service that more narrowly focused, specialised rivals simply can not achieve.
